Elias Wilfredo (Beve) Lozano, age 80, went to be with the Lord on April 28, 2023. Elias was born in Elsa, Texas to Jose (Monse) Lozano and Delia Campbell Lozano on October 12, 1942. There is where he grew up with his siblings. Not only did Beve enjoy and participate in all sports, but he was the star quarterback for Edcouch Elsa High School.
Later he moved to Immokalee, Florida then, returned to Texas where he lived the remainder of his life. He enjoyed traveling as well as visiting with his family. He was a friend to all and loved by everyone he met. Beve always greeted you with a big, beautiful smile. Besides his knowledge of building a business, he was also skilled in cooking, and barbequing was his specialty. He enjoyed life to its fullest.
At one point in life, Beve owned several drinking establishments all located in the Houston area. He was a natural born entrepreneur. He always dressed sharp and was always ready to make a deal. Elias fought courageously for the last five years of his life. He will be truly missed by all who loved him and those who called him friend.
Beve was preceded in death by, his parents, Jose and Delia Lozano; his brothers, Rogelio, Artemio, and Joe Jr. Lozano; and by his baby boy Lozano, whom he never forgot. He is survived by his children: son, David Lozano; daughters, Sylvia Palacios and husband Joseph, Elsa Cisneros and husband Mark, Delia Gonatas and husband Antony; sons, Elias Garcia, and Rene Garcia and wife Enriqueta; 17 grandchildren; 38 great-grandchildren; and four, great-great grandchildren; siblings, Glendelia (Glendy) Lozano; and numerous cousins.
